[bodytext] => To the one I love: I wrote you a letter, to make you feel better, about your recent plight, I licked the envelope, filled it with a little hope, and sealed it tight, I stuck it in a basket, which sat next to your jacket, and wished for you to read, You’d never come back, you’re on a one way track, and reality’s taken the lead, So: I smiled to the sky, jumped up to fly and fell straight back down, I wanted to be with you, but my life still holds true, and I’m still here on the ground, So when you fly over me, look down to see, and remember that I’m here, And remember how together we'd lay, from night until day, and reflect on a life that was dear.
